blockly > HorizontalFlyout

Classe HorizontalFlyout

Classe para um menu suspenso.

Signature:

export declare class HorizontalFlyout extends Flyout 

Estende: Suspenso

Construtores

Construtor Modificadores Descrição
(construtor)(workspaceOptions) Cria uma nova instância da classe HorizontalFlyout

Propriedades

Propriedade Modificadores Tipo Descrição
horizontalLayout boolean

Métodos

Método Modificadores Descrição
getClientRect() Retorna o retângulo delimitador da área de destino da ação de arrastar em unidades de pixels em relação à janela de visualização.
getX() (link em inglês) Calcula a coordenada x para a posição suspensa.
getY() (link em inglês) Calcula a coordenada y para a posição suspensa.
layout_(conteúdos, lacunas) protected Distribua os blocos no menu suspenso.
position(). Mova o menu suspenso para a borda do espaço de trabalho.
reflowInternal_() protected Calcule a altura do menu suspenso. Tapete toolkit.Position sob cada bloco. Para RTL: posicionar os blocos alinhados à direita.
scrollToStart() Role o menu suspenso para a parte de cima.
setMetrics_(xyRatio) protected Define a translação do menu suspenso para corresponder às barras de rolagem.
wheel_(e) protected Role o menu suspenso.